How to fill out 8th grade poetry unit

How to fill out 8th grade poetry unit?
01
Start by familiarizing yourself with the objectives and expectations of the poetry unit. Read the syllabus or guidelines provided by your teacher to understand what you will be learning and the assignments you will be completing.
02
Begin exploring different types of poetry. Read a variety of poems from different poets and time periods. Take note of the different forms and styles of poetry, as well as the themes and emotions they express.
03
Develop your understanding of poetic devices and techniques. Learn about literary devices such as similes, metaphors, personification, alliteration, and rhyme. Understand how these devices enhance the meaning and impact of a poem.
04
Practice analyzing poetry. Look closely at the structure, language, and overall message of different poems. Consider the tone, mood, and imagery used by the poet and identify the main themes and symbols present in the poem.
05
Experiment with writing your own poetry. Start by imitating the styles and structures of the poems you have studied. Then, gradually develop your own unique voice and style. Don't be afraid to express your thoughts, feelings, and experiences through your poems.
06
Seek feedback from your teacher, peers, or writing groups. Sharing your poetry with others can help you improve and gain new perspectives. Listen to constructive criticism and use it to refine your writing skills.
07
Revise and edit your poems. Pay attention to the rhythm, flow, and word choice in your writing. Make sure your ideas are clear and well-organized. Polish your work until it reflects your best effort.
